HR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2016 in Review

255 of the 3,749 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Healthcare Realty (HR) for Q2 2016, worth a combined $3.82B — up 21% from $3.16B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 43 funds opened new HR positions and 16 closed out — a net gain of 27 holders — while 115 added to existing stakes and 65 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Bank of New York Mellon, adding an estimated $67.6M. The largest seller was Visium Asset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$70.1M sold.
